System of a Down rocker Serj Tankian’s latest album, Harakiri, is streaming for free on therock.net.nz.
The third solo album from Tankian was recorded at his home studio in Los Angeles.
“I used the Apple iPad as a songwriting instrument to sketch out three of the songs on the record,” says Tankian.
“We must trick ourselves into writing in different ways to get unexpected results.”
Tankian explains that the album title, which means ritualistic suicide in Japanese, is reflective of how he sees the human species eradicating themselves on a large scale.
“The record is different than any I've made as a solo artist,” says Tankian.
“It is much more driving and punk oriented with influences ranging from goth to electronic to ‘80s vibes, dynamically heavy rock to epic melodic songs.
“Lyrically, it spans the gauntlet of themes from personal, political and philosophical to spiritual, humour and love.”
